R-2018 I Lt7 A RESOLUTION OF THE CITY COMMISSION OF THE CITY OF TAMARAC, FLORIDA, IN SUPPORT OF THE CITY OF SUNRISE'S COMPLETE STREETS AND OTHER LOCALIZED INITIATIVES PROGRAM APPLICATION TO ADD BIKE LANES, SIDEWALKS, CURBS AND GUTTERS ALONG NW 94T" AVENUE WITHIN THE CITY OF SUNRISE'S RIGHT OF WAY AND THE CITY OF TAMARAC RIGHT OF WAY, BETWEEN COMMERCIAL BOULEVARD AND NW 57T" STREET; PROVIDING FOR CONFLICTS; PROVIDING FOR SEVERABILITY; AND PROVIDING FOR AN EFFECTIVE DATE. WHEREAS, the Broward Metropolitan Planning Organization (MPO) provides funds to eligible local governments for transportation related projects, such as traffic calming and bike facilities, through their Complete Streets and Other Localized Initiatives Program (CSLIP), and WHEREAS, the MPO will disburse competitive grant funding to local governments based on applications submitted; and WHEREAS, the City of Tamarac desires to provide a safe connectivity between city facilities, schools, shopping areas, residential areas and the Broward County Greenway system by establishing an integrated bikeway/walkway system throughout the City, and WHEREAS, the project is expected to aid in City's Strategic Goal #5, "A Vibrant Community", which states, "The City of Tamarac will provide resources, initiatives and opportunities to continually revitalize our community and preserve the environment", and WHEREAS, the proposed project supports current efforts to enhance multi -modal transportation, wellness and recreational opportunities throughout Tamarac, and is Temp. Reso. #13204 November 14, 2018 Page 2 consistent with the transportation element of the City of Tamarac's Parks and Recreation and Social Services Master Plan; and WHEREAS, the City Commission of the City of Tamarac supports the City of Sunrise's application for the NW 94th Avenue Bike Lane Project to provide connectivity between the existing bike lane projects along NW 94th Avenue between NW 44th Street and NW 57th Street, to provide connectivity to Westpine Middle School, Millennium Middle School, and Challenger Elementary School, as well as nearby parks, a copy of the proposed CSLIP Project location and description is attached hereto as "Exhibit 1" and is incorporated herein and made a specific part of this Resolution; and WHEREAS, the City of Tamarac supports the Florida Department of Transportation's management of the design and construction of the proposed 94th Avenue Bike Lane Project, if selected, on the City's behalf; and N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ED BY THE CITY COMMISSION OF THE CITY OF TAMARAC, FLORIDA THAT: SECTION 1: The foregoing "WHEREAS" clauses are hereby ratified and confirmed as being true and correct and are hereby made a specific part of this Resolution upon adoption hereof.
